Default DIY upholstery

Working to reupholster the seat and seat back on my 29 coupe and wondering about the correct height for the front edge of the seat. Have put a new cover, padding etc on the springs and wooden frame and height is now roughly 7". I compressed the springs as best I could while putting on the homemade cover. Looks pretty good. Not a show car by any means, I just want to be able to drive it.
